# Broker Upgrade: Env Vars

Heads up for the review of the Quillbus 4.x migration: the worker now reads BROKER_HOST, BROKER_VHOST (use /relay), and TLS_MIN=1.3 from .env instead of the old YAML. Nothing else moved. The very next line after TLS_MIN sets the broker password.

sealed setting: ARCHIVE_KEY3=8d0

## Audit Log Viewer: Limits & Quotas

Heads up, plugin folks: the Pennycraft audit-log viewer isn't built for bulk export, so don't treat the query API like a firehose. Pagination is mandatory, time windows are capped, and repeated full-range scans will get your plugin throttled. If you need the whole log, use the nightly snapshot feed instead. The enforced limits are listed here.

tuning table, faduf-baduf:
PRIORITIES = {
    "ulavan": 191,
    "silys": 750,
    "goriel": 238,
    "kelmir": 66,
    "wendor": 432,
}

/*
 * Sets up the client for Splitvane, our internal A/B experiment
 * assignment service. Every request must include a stable unit ID
 * (user or device) so assignments stay deterministic across sessions;
 * never generate a fresh ID per request or you'll skew exposure logs.
 * Assignments are cached locally for 60 seconds — don't lower this,
 * Splitvane rate-limits aggressively. New team members: use the staging
 * cluster until your first experiment review. The client authenticates
 * with the service key below.
 */

gateway credential: kto3_qfe

Heads-up on sorting in Tablewright's report builder: as of 5.4, sorts are now stable. Previously, rows with equal keys could reorder between runs, which made diff-based release checks noisy. Now ties preserve insertion order, so your regression diffs should finally be clean. Nothing changes in the request shape — same `sort` param, same comparators. One caveat: cached reports built before 5.4 keep their old ordering until regenerated. To trigger bulk regeneration, hit the internal rebuild endpoint, authenticating with the key below.

service key, tadup-tahog: zpat7_wB1tnEL